WebFeb 13, 2024 · Step 3: Quick Soak the Beans. Once your salt has dissolved, and you’ve got your pot of beans on the stove, turn the burner to medium-high heat. Bring the water to a rolling boil, but only allow it to boil for 2 minutes. After 2 minutes of boiling, cover the pot with a tight-fitting lid and turn off the heat. WebMar 22, 2024 · Employ the “quick-soak” method: Cover beans with 2 to 3 inches of cool water, bring to a boil, then remove from heat, cover, and let sit for an hour.) WebSep 13, 2024 · Bring beans to a boil in a large pot with fresh water by covering and boiling them. Cook beans in the lower heat, lid, and slowly until tender but firm. Depending on the variety, most beans take between 45 minutes and two hours to cook. WebMar 24, 2024 · Add the beans to the pressure cooker with four cups of water and one teaspoon salt for each cup of beans. Cover the pressure cooker and lock the lid in place. Bring the pressure cooker to high pressure over high heat. Reduce the heat to maintain the pressure and cook for two minutes. WebRinse the beans and then place them in a pot with three cups of water for each cup of dried beans. Bring to a boil and boil for two to three minutes. Remove the pot from the heat, cover and let stand for one hour. Drain the water, add fresh water and cook. WebApr 14, 2024 · Protip: Adjust for large Instant Pots.
